Data Review
- Is there or will there be documentation that describes the schema for the ultimate data set in a public, complete, and accurate way?
Yes, through the metrics.yaml file and the Glean Dictionary.
- Is there a control mechanism that allows the user to turn the data collection on and off?
Yes, through the data preferences at mozilla.org
- If the request is for permanent data collection, is there someone who will monitor the data over time?
N/A, collection to end in 6 months with the possibility of being renewed at that time.
- Using the category system of data types on the Mozilla wiki, what collection type of data do the requested measurements fall under?
Category 1, Technical data
- Is the data collection request for default-on or default-off?
Default-on
- Does the instrumentation include the addition of any new identifiers (whether anonymous or otherwise; e.g., username, random IDs, etc. See the appendix for more details)?
No
- Is the data collection covered by the existing Firefox privacy notice?
Yes
- Does the data collection use a third-party collection tool?
No
Result
data-review+
